Why Vitamin D Matters for Diabetics Who Don't Eat Fish
Vitamin D is far more than just a bone health nutrient. For individuals managing diabetes, adequate vitamin D status plays a direct role in glucose metabolism and insulin sensitivity. Research suggests that sufficient vitamin D levels may improve glycemic control and reduce the risk of diabetes-related complications. Yet for those who avoid fish—whether due to allergy, ethical preference, or taste—the challenge of meeting vitamin D requirements becomes more pronounced. Fish like salmon, mackerel, and sardines are among the richest natural food sources, but they are not the only option. A well-planned plant-based, fish-free diet can still deliver the vitamin D needed to support bone density, immune function, and stable blood sugar regulation.
The stakes are higher for diabetics because vitamin D deficiency is more common in this population. Poor kidney function, a common diabetes complication, impairs the conversion of vitamin D into its active form. Additionally, many diabetics carry excess body fat, which sequesters vitamin D and reduces its bioavailability. This makes intentional dietary choices and supplementation far more critical. The good news is that fortified plant foods, UV-exposed mushrooms, and strategic sun exposure can bridge the gap when animal sources are off the table.
Understanding Vitamin D: D2 vs. D3 for Plant-Based Diets
When evaluating plant-based vitamin D sources, it's important to distinguish between vitamin D2 (ergocalciferol) and vitamin D3 (cholecalciferol). Vitamin D2 is produced by fungi when exposed to UV light, while vitamin D3 is synthesized in the skin of animals and humans upon sun exposure. Most plant-based foods provide D2, which some research indicates may be less potent at raising and maintaining blood levels of vitamin D compared to D3. However, D2 still contributes meaningfully to overall status, especially when consumed consistently. Some plant-based vitamin D3 supplements derived from lichen are now available and offer a direct vegan alternative to lanolin-based D3.
For diabetics avoiding fish, the practical question is whether D2 from plants is sufficient. The evidence shows that regular intake of D2 from fortified foods or UV-exposed mushrooms can improve vitamin D status, particularly when combined with sensible sun exposure. Monitoring serum 25-hydroxyvitamin D levels through routine blood tests remains the gold standard for determining whether your intake is adequate.
Top Plant-Based Vitamin D Sources for Fish-Free Diabetics
UV-Exposed Mushrooms: The Only Natural Plant Source
Mushrooms are unique in the plant kingdom because they synthesize vitamin D when exposed to ultraviolet light, just as human skin does. However, the crucial detail is that most commercially grown mushrooms are cultivated in darkness and contain negligible vitamin D unless intentionally treated with UV light. UV-exposed mushrooms such as maitake, UV-treated portobello, and shiitake can provide substantial amounts of vitamin D2. A single serving of UV-exposed portobello mushrooms can deliver 100% or more of the daily value for vitamin D, rivaling the content found in fish.
When purchasing mushrooms, look for labels that specify "UV-treated" or "high in vitamin D." You can also expose button mushrooms or cremini mushrooms to direct sunlight for 15–30 minutes before cooking to boost their vitamin D content. This simple hack works because mushrooms contain ergosterol, a precursor that converts to vitamin D2 upon UV exposure. For diabetics, mushrooms also provide selenium, B vitamins, and fiber with a low glycemic impact, making them an ideal addition to meals.
Fortified Plant Milks: A Convenient Daily Source
Fortified plant milks are among the most reliable and convenient sources of vitamin D for fish-free diabetics. Almond milk, soy milk, oat milk, coconut milk, and rice milk are frequently enriched with vitamin D2 or plant-derived D3. The fortification level varies by brand, but a standard cup (240 ml) typically provides between 100 and 144 IU of vitamin D. For context, the recommended daily intake for adults is 600–800 IU, though many experts suggest higher targets for diabetics. Choosing a fortified plant milk that you drink daily ensures a steady baseline of intake. Always check the nutrition label to confirm vitamin D fortification, as not all brands add it.
Beyond vitamin D, many fortified plant milks are also enriched with calcium and vitamin B12, which are important for bone health and energy metabolism. For diabetics, unsweetened varieties are preferable to avoid added sugars that can spike blood glucose.
Fortified Breakfast Cereals: An Easy Morning Boost
Fortified breakfast cereals offer another convenient vehicle for vitamin D. Many popular brands add vitamin D to their cereals, typically providing 40–100 IU per serving. When selecting cereals, choose those made from whole grains and with minimal added sugar to align with diabetes management goals. Pair fortified cereal with fortified plant milk for a combined vitamin D boost in the morning. This strategy is especially helpful for individuals who struggle to obtain enough vitamin D from other foods in their diet.
As with plant milks, read the ingredient list and nutrition facts panel. Some cereals use vitamin D3 derived from lanolin, so if you strictly avoid all animal products, look for cereals that specify D2 or plant-based D3.
Fortified Orange Juice: A Citrus Alternative
Several brands of orange juice are fortified with vitamin D and calcium, making them a viable option for diabetics who tolerate citrus. A typical 8-ounce glass of fortified orange juice provides around 100 IU of vitamin D. Because orange juice contains natural sugars, portion control and blood glucose monitoring are important. Some brands offer lower-sugar or "light" versions with reduced carbohydrate content. If orange juice fits within your individual carbohydrate budget, it can serve as a complementary source of vitamin D along with other fortified foods.
Tofu, Tempeh, and Other Soy Products
Some brands of tofu and tempeh are fortified with vitamin D during processing, though this is less common than fortification of milks or cereals. Check the nutrition label on your tofu or tempeh package to see if vitamin D has been added. Unfortified soy products contain minimal natural vitamin D, but they remain valuable for diabetes management due to their high protein content and low glycemic index. When you find fortified versions, they can contribute a modest amount of vitamin D to your daily intake.
Fortified Margarine and Plant-Based Butters
Many plant-based margarines and spreads are fortified with vitamin D, along with vitamin A and omega-3 fatty acids. As with other fortified foods, the amounts vary by brand. Using a fortified spread on whole-grain toast or in cooking can add a small but consistent amount of vitamin D to your diet. Look for products made from non-hydrogenated oils to avoid trans fats, which are detrimental to cardiovascular health in diabetics.
Strategies to Maximize Vitamin D Absorption and Utilization
Adequate intake of vitamin D is only part of the equation. For diabetics on a fish-free, plant-based diet, several factors influence how effectively the body absorbs and uses vitamin D. Optimizing these factors can make a meaningful difference in your vitamin D status without requiring additional food intake.
Pair Vitamin D with Fat for Better Absorption
Vitamin D is fat-soluble, meaning it requires dietary fat for proper absorption. When consuming vitamin D-rich or fortified foods, combine them with a source of healthy fat. Add avocado to your tofu scramble, drizzle olive oil over UV-exposed mushrooms, or choose fortified plant milk in a smoothie with nut butter. This simple practice can significantly increase the amount of vitamin D that reaches your bloodstream.
Monitor Calcium and Magnesium Levels
Vitamin D works synergistically with calcium and magnesium. Magnesium is required for the enzymatic conversion of vitamin D into its active form, and many diabetics have suboptimal magnesium levels. Include magnesium-rich plant foods such as spinach, almonds, cashews, black beans, and pumpkin seeds in your diet. Calcium intake from fortified plant milks, leafy greens, or fortified tofu should also be adequate to support vitamin D function in bone health.
Sunlight Exposure: The Original Source
No discussion of vitamin D is complete without addressing sunlight. For fish-free diabetics, sensible sun exposure remains one of the most effective ways to maintain vitamin D status. Aim for 10–30 minutes of midday sun exposure on a large area of skin, several times per week, depending on your skin type, latitude, and climate. Exposing arms and legs without sunscreen for a short period before applying protection is a common recommendation. Factors such as age, skin pigmentation, and obesity can reduce the skin's ability to synthesize vitamin D, so personal adjustment is necessary. Sun exposure that produces a light pinkness after 24 hours indicates sufficient UV exposure for vitamin D synthesis.
During winter months or in northern latitudes, sunlight alone may be insufficient. In those situations, fortified foods and supplements become even more important.
Supplementation: When Diet and Sun Aren't Enough
For many diabetics avoiding fish, supplementation offers the most reliable way to achieve optimal vitamin D levels. Vitamin D2 supplements are widely available and suitable for any diet, while plant-based vitamin D3 from lichen provides a vegan alternative that matches the form produced by the human body. The appropriate dosage depends on your current blood levels, body weight, dietary intake, and sun exposure. Typical maintenance doses range from 600–2000 IU per day for adults, though higher doses may be needed to correct deficiency. Always consult a healthcare provider before starting supplementation, as vitamin D is fat-soluble and excessively high doses can be toxic.
When selecting a supplement, look for third-party testing verification to ensure purity and potency. Some supplements also include vitamin K2, which works alongside vitamin D to direct calcium into bones rather than soft tissues. For diabetics, this combination may offer additional cardiovascular benefits.
Sample Daily Plan for Plant-Based Vitamin D Intake
Here is a practical example of how a fish-free diabetic might meet their vitamin D needs through plant-based sources alone, without supplements. Adjust portions and choices based on your individual carbohydrate tolerance and preferences.
- Breakfast: 1 cup of unsweetened fortified oat milk (120 IU) with a bowl of fortified whole-grain cereal (60 IU).
- Lunch: Large salad with 1 cup sautéed UV-exposed portobello mushrooms (400 IU) dressed with olive oil and lemon juice.
- Snack: 1 cup of fortified orange juice (100 IU).
- Dinner: Stir-fry with fortified tofu and a side of steamed broccoli drizzled with fortified plant-based margarine.
- Total approximate intake: 680–780 IU from food, plus any additional contribution from sun exposure.
This pattern demonstrates that with thoughtful food selection, a fish-free diabetic can approach or meet the recommended intake without relying on a single source. On days when sun exposure is limited, a supplement can fill the gap.
Special Considerations for Diabetics
Diabetes introduces specific factors that affect vitamin D metabolism. Kidney function declines in many diabetics, reducing the conversion of vitamin D to its active form (calcitriol). This means that even with adequate intake, diabetics with compromised kidney function may require higher doses or active vitamin D analogs under medical supervision. Additionally, obesity is common in type 2 diabetes, and excess adipose tissue sequesters vitamin D, reducing its bioavailability. Higher body weight often correlates with lower serum vitamin D levels, necessitating larger intakes to achieve sufficiency.
Medications used in diabetes management can also interact with vitamin D. Thiazolidinediones, for example, may reduce bone density, making vitamin D adequacy even more critical. Metformin has been associated with lower vitamin D levels in some studies, though the relationship is not fully understood. Regular blood testing of 25-hydroxyvitamin D levels is recommended for diabetics, with follow-up testing three to six months after adjusting intake or supplementation.
Myths and Facts About Plant-Based Vitamin D
Myth: Spinach, kale, and other leafy greens are good sources of vitamin D.
Fact: Leafy greens are excellent for general health and provide magnesium and calcium, but they contain virtually no vitamin D. Relying on vegetables alone will not meet vitamin D requirements.
Myth: Fortified foods provide enough vitamin D on their own for everyone.
Fact: Fortified foods can contribute meaningfully, but the amounts added are often modest. Many diabetics—especially those with dark skin, limited sun exposure, or higher body weight—still require a supplement.
Myth: You can get all the vitamin D you need from sunlight year-round.
Fact: Sunlight is seasonally and geographically inconsistent. Above 37 degrees latitude, the UVB rays necessary for vitamin D synthesis are insufficient from November through March. Cloud cover, pollution, and indoor lifestyles further limit production.
